Personal Details of Bernie Taupin
Full Name | Bernard John Taupin |
Birth Date | May 22, 1950 |
Birth Place | Anwick, Lincolnshire, England |
Primary Role | Lyricist, Songwriter |
Known For | Collaboration with Elton John |
Artistic Interests | Painting, Poetry, Writing |

The turning point, perhaps, came when he connected with Reginald Dwight, who would later become known as Elton John. This partnership, formed after both responded to that same music paper ad, was a coming together of two different, yet perfectly matched, talents. Bernie had the words, and Elton had the melodies. Together, they found a way to make music that truly spoke to people. It was, you know, a bit of magic happening right there.
Their working method was quite special, too. Bernie would write the words, often without knowing what kind of tune they would have, and then Elton would put music to them. This separation of tasks allowed each person to fully focus on their own part of the creative process. It meant that Bernie's words stood on their own, strong and full of meaning, before any sound was added. This approach, you know, might be one reason why their songs feel so complete.
